WebUrine tests for cocaine typically can detect cocaine metabolites for two to four days after the last use of the stimulant drug. However, for people who heavily use cocaine, the drug can be detected in urine drug screens for as long as 14 days after the last use. WebGenerally speaking, cocaine can be detected in urine samples for up to 4 days after last use. In blood samples, cocaine can be detected for up to 48 hours after last use. Detection times may be longer or shorter depending on individual factors such as metabolism rate and amount of drug taken. Hair samples can detect cocaine for up to 90 days ...

WebAfter last use, cocaine or its metabolites typically can show up on a blood or saliva test for up to 2 days, a urine test for up to 3 days, and a hair test for months to years. A heavy user can test positive on a urine test for up to 2 weeks.
